STATE CLIMB: Who We Are
State Climb is one of only a few nonprofit climbing gyms in the country. We’re working to ensure everyone has access to the sport and all of the social, emotional, and mental health benefits that come along with being a part of the greater climbing community.
Our mission: To promote social, mental, and emotional health through physical activity and community engagement.
Our Vision: We serve the local community 7 days a week, 360+ days a year by providing safe, fun, and high quality climbing experiences, and by providing an equitable, accessible, safe space for everyone to recreate and foster a stronger sense of self within the community.
We offer low or no-cost programming to local school systems, as well as offer Pay What You Like access to our youth teams, leagues, and summer programs.
Pay What You Like (PWYL)
Since 2021, State Climb has pioneered a few different iterations of a gym model that prioritizes economic accessibility. We’ve adapted to fit our community’s needs along the way, and through that experience we have learned how best to serve our community. We now implement PWYL in the following way:
At this time, nearly 1/3 of our campers, team participants, and league participants are booked through our PWYL program. PWYL enrollment is offered alongside normal enrollment for each of the programs in the form of an additional question added after the price.
“Does this price not work for you? If it does not, Click here to tell us how much you’d like to pay.”
We do not exclude participants based on any eligibility requirements. If you ask for help, and if we are able to give it, we will help you.
